In automatic doors, an electromagnet is used to create a magnetic field that attracts or repels a metal plate on the door. When an electrical current is applied to the electromagnet, it generates a magnetic force that moves the metal plate, allowing the door to open or close automatically. This process is controlled by sensors that detect movement, ensuring the door operates efficiently.
Both permanent magnets and electromagnets can be used on doors. Permanent magnets are used in simple applications like cabinet doors, while electromagnets are commonly used in commercial settings for security doors or in access control systems. Electromagnets can be activated and deactivated as needed, providing greater control over door access.
Electromagnets are used for fire doors by holding them open during normal operation and releasing them to close automatically in case of a fire alarm. The magnets are connected to the fire alarm system and are designed to deactivate when the alarm is triggered, allowing the doors to close and block the spread of fire and smoke.
